Aiming to be the OpenTable of kids’ activities, Sawyer raises $1.5 million
In fact, that vision partly explains the $1.5 million that seven-month-old Sawyer was able to raise from investors, including Notation Capital, Collaborative Fund, VC1, and other strategic angel investors. (Part of that money was raised last fall via a convertible note; Sawyer converted that funding into equity and closed on some more this past Friday.)

Sawyer, a software platform for kid classes, raises $6 million, including from the Chan Zuckerberg Initiative
Sawyer CEO and co-founder Marissa Evans Alden suggests it’s a big opportunity that’s just waiting to be exploited. “None of these vendors run on any type of [sophisticated] software,” she says. She likens what Sawyer is building to the cloud-based business management software made by publicly traded MindBody, which caters to the wellness industry and went public in 2015....
